Responsibilities
Tasks
-
Address and document symptoms and changes in patients’ conditions
-
Assess patients to identify appropriate nursing interventions
-
Collaborate with members of an interdisciplinary health team to plan, implement, co-ordinate and evaluate patient care in consultation with patients and their families
-
Conduct disease screening
-
Deliver health education programs
-
Deliver immunization programs
-
Dispense and administer medications and treatments as prescribed by a physician
-
Engage in research activities related to nursing
-
Manage home care cases
-
Operate or monitor medical apparatus or equipment
-
Provide nursing care
-
Supervise licensed practical nurses and other nursing staff
